The Manx government believes it's got things right for TT 2010, after being roundly criticised for the entertainment offered at last year's festival.
Nightly stunt shows outside the Villa Marina and big screens recapping the day's action, celebrity quiz shows, and top class comedians and bands are some of the attractions on offer.
